選擇nginx的負載均衡策略取決于你的具體需求和環境。以下是一些常見的nginx負載均衡策略:
輪詢(Round Robin):默認的負載均衡策略,將請求依次分發給每個后端服務器,適用于后端服務器性能相近的情況。
加權輪詢(Weighted Round Robin):可以為每個后端服務器設置不同的權重,來實現根據服務器性能或負載情況動態調整請求分發比例。
IP哈希(IP Hash):根據客戶端IP地址將請求分發給后端服務器,確保同一個客戶端的請求始終被發送到同一個后端服務器,適用于需要保持會話一致性的情況。
最小連接數(Least Connections):將請求發送給當前連接數最少的后端服務器,可以有效地分擔服務器負載。
最快響應時間(Least Time):將請求發送給響應時間最短的后端服務器,可以提高整體響應速度。
選擇哪種負載均衡策略取決于你的具體需求,如服務器性能、負載情況、會話一致性等。可以根據實際情況進行測試和調整,找到最適合自己的負載均衡策略。